BIO-330 Public Health Biology Prerequisite: BIO-222 and any one of the following BIO-210, BIO-211, BIO-212, or BIO-213 A study of the biological principles of human diseases and conditions of public health importance and the applications of the principles in biology and public health for treatments and preventions. Laboratory work includes microbiology, computer exercises, and field trips. 4 credits.
